Why Windshield Washer Fluid Hose Replacement Is Necessary
I learned that replacing a windshield washer fluid hose is important because even a small crack or leak can stop the washer system from working properly. When the hose gets old, brittle, or damaged, the fluid may not reach the windshield at all, which makes it harder for me to keep the glass clean while driving. That can quickly become a safety issue, especially in rain, snow, or when dirt and bugs block my view.
I also found that a faulty hose can waste washer fluid and create messes under the hood or around the vehicle. If I ignore the problem too long, the damage can spread to other parts of the washer system, like the pump or nozzles, leading to more expensive repairs. Replacing the hose early helps me keep the system reliable and avoids bigger problems later.
For me, it’s a simple maintenance step that protects visibility, saves money, and keeps my car safer to drive.
My Buying Guides on Windshield Washer Fluid Hose Replacement
When I first had to deal with a cracked or leaking windshield washer fluid hose, I realized it was a small part that could cause a big inconvenience. My washer system stopped spraying properly, and I quickly learned that choosing the right replacement hose matters more than I expected. Here’s my buying guide based on what I look for when replacing a windshield washer fluid hose.
1. I Check the Hose Size First
The first thing I always verify is the hose diameter. Washer fluid hoses usually come in common sizes, but not every vehicle uses the same one. I make sure the inner diameter matches my original hose so the fit is snug and won’t leak.
2. I Look for Washer-Fluid-Resistant Material
I prefer a hose made from durable rubber, silicone, or reinforced plastic that can handle washer fluid without cracking. Since the hose sits in a hot and cold environment under the hood, I want something that resists heat, cold, and chemical exposure.
3. I Consider Flexibility and Ease of Installation
When I replace a hose, I want one that bends easily around engine components without kinking. A flexible hose makes installation much easier, especially if I’m routing it through tight spaces or around clips and connectors.
4. I Make Sure It Matches My Vehicle’s Washer System
I always check whether I need a standard hose, a T-connector, or a preformed hose section. Some vehicles have simple straight runs, while others need special shapes or fittings. Matching the replacement to my vehicle saves time and prevents frustration.
5. I Inspect the Length Before Buying
I measure the old hose or estimate the full route before ordering. I’d rather have a little extra length than come up short during installation. If I’m replacing multiple sections, I make sure I buy enough for the entire job.
6. I Look for a Secure Fit with Connectors
I pay attention to how the hose connects to the washer pump, nozzles, and any junctions. A good replacement hose should grip tightly and work well with clamps or push-fit connectors if needed. Loose connections can cause leaks or weak spray pressure.
7. I Choose Weather and UV Resistance
Since the hose is exposed to engine heat and sometimes sunlight, I look for materials that won’t degrade quickly. UV-resistant and weather-resistant hoses usually last longer, which means fewer replacements later.
8. I Compare OEM and Universal Options
Sometimes I choose an OEM-style hose for exact fitment, especially if I want a straightforward replacement. Other times, a universal washer hose works fine if it matches the size and material I need. I decide based on how specific my vehicle’s setup is.
9. I Check Reviews for Durability
Before I buy, I like to read reviews from other drivers. If people mention cracking, leaking, or poor fit after a short time, I usually avoid that product. Real-world feedback helps me find hoses that actually hold up.
10. I Keep a Few Extra Accessories on Hand
When I replace the hose, I often grab a few extra items like hose clips, T-fittings, and connectors. Having these ready makes the repair smoother and helps me avoid stopping halfway through the job.
